Handsworth New Road is in Birmingham and in Birmingham district. B18 4PH is located in the Soho & Jewellery Quarter elect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Birmingham, Ladywood.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.
In the immediate area around B18 4PH,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 48.2%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Single | 33% | 48.2% | 15.2% | 37.9% | 10.3% |
| Married: Opposite sex | 40.1% | 33.5% | -6.6% | 44.2% | -10.7% |
| Separated | 8% | 5.9% | -2.1% | 2.2% | 3.7% |
| Divorced | 8.9% | 7.3% | -1.6% | 9.1% | -1.8% |
| Widowed | 10% | 5.1% | -4.9% | 6.1% | -1.0% |

During the 2021 census, the educational qualifications of residents across the UK were as follows: 18.2% had no qualifications, 9.6% had 1-4 GCSEs, 13.4% had 5 or more GCSEs and 1-2 A/AS Levels, 16.9% had 2 or more A Levels, 33.8% held a degree (or equivalent), and 5.4% had completed an apprenticeship.
In the area around B18 4PH this area, 29.5% of residents have no qualifications. This is significantly higher than the UK average of 18.2%. This area stands out for its low percentage of residents with higher education degree. The UK average is 33.8%, while in this area it is 21.5%.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| No qualifications | 36.1% | 29.5% | -6.6% | 18.2% | 11.3% |
| 1-4 GCSEs or Equivalent | 15.5% | 11.6% | -3.9% | 9.6% | 2.0% |
| 5 or more GCSEs, an A-Level or 1-2 AS Levels | 12.9% | 10.8% | -2.1% | 13.4% | -2.6% |
| Apprenticeship | 0.9% | 3.1% | 2.2% | 5.3% | -2.2% |
| HNC, HND or 2+ A Levels | 7.4% | 20.1% | 12.7% | 16.9% | 3.2% |
| Degree or Similar | 12.6% | 21.5% | 8.9% | 33.8% | -12.3% |
| Other | 14.6% | 3.4% | -11.2% | 2.8% | 0.6% |

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Handsworth New Road was 178.0 per 1,000 residents, which is 7.3% lower than the Handsworth average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
Handsworth New Road has the 27th highest crime rate of 74 local areas in Handsworth and the 625th highest crime rate of 3,083 local areas in Birmingham .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 96.9 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 44.9%.
